You've probably heard that the TIO has submitted a lease permit for the Canary Islands but don't doubt their desire to still want Mauna Kea for TMT. Governor Ige has extended the TMT lease two years (2021). Canada's involvement in TMT is both through government and private industry. There are two critical components Canada is supplying TMT, the adaptive optics system (NFIRAOS) and the Calotte dome enclosure. Without AO which allows the telescope to see past our atmosphere and the dome which protects the telescope, TMT can't operate.
